Please ignore my question about audio going offline.  I just had to reset a
couple of things.  I may have missed the Studio Controls icon - after a
reboot, the menu was back to normal.  In controls, I was able to select
"USB device that should be Master" to my external soundcard.  I had also
attempted to restart pulse, but not sure whether that worked or contributed
to the fix.  And made sure Jack Setup was OK.  Did not test everything yet,
but I think I'm back on track and should be able to deal with it from here.

> I don't know for certain that the last update caused my audio problem.
> Sound is choppy as in a square wave, regular interval.  This is with the
> DAW,  audio player, browser, anything that makes sound.  I should add all
> Jack audio connections that had been set up were disconnected.  Connecting
> Pulse to system out makes the choppy sound, otherwise it's mute.  And there
> are suddenly a lot of subfolders exploded in the Audio/Effects menu, I
> think because U. Studio Controls vanished.  There's been an alert pop-up
> "found a problem with you system. notify?" from the time I first upgraded
> last Friday, so maybe that's the real origin of this bug.  Did not look at
> error log yet and don't know what diagnostics to run.  For now I was just
> wondering if this is just me or a* known issue*?   I'm on an older Lenovo
> ThinkPad.
